More fact-gathering and studying on short-term rentals is underway in Plano as City Council members also consider more immediate solutions.
The city is now moving forward with forming a short-term rental task force that would consider opinions on both sides of the issue.
A timeline for gathering more information on short-term rentals includes a community survey that will be completed in May and a town hall meeting in late July or early August. In all, the information-gathering process could extend into spring of next year.
Additionally, a task force would make a recommendation to the Plano Planning and Zoning Commission, and then a report would be made to City Council, City Manager Mark Israelson said during the April 10 Plano City Council meeting.
